    Introduction About ALKA SODA SACHET

    ALKA SODA SACHET contains Sodium Bicarbonate, which belongs to the group of medicines called alkalizers. It is used for the management of indigestion and metabolic acidosis (a condition in which the amount of acid in body fluids is increased, causing palpitations, vomiting, confusion, nausea, etc.) caused by severe kidney disorders, uncontrolled diabetes, severe lactic acidosis or severe dehydration. It is also used as a replacement therapy for severe diarrhoea and to reduce the occurrence of chemical phlebitis (irritation caused by too acidic I.V. drugs and fluids).

    ALKA SODA SACHET is not recommended for use in patients who have high alkali levels in the blood, low blood calcium levels or low levels of stomach acid. It is also not recommended in patients who have previously experienced heart failure, have kidney or liver problems, seizures, high blood pressure or breathing difficulties. Consult your doctor before taking ALKA SODA SACHET.

    ALKA SODA SACHET should only be used in pregnant or breastfeeding women when absolutely necessary. ALKA SODA SACHET is not recommended for use by children. The most common side effects after taking ALKA SODA SACHET are abdominal pain, flatulence (gas), high blood pressure, etc. Consult your doctor immediately if any of the side effects worsen.

    How ALKA SODA SACHET Works

    ALKA SODA SACHET works by increasing plasma bicarbonate levels, which in result buffers excess hydrogen ion concentration and increases the pH and hence relieving symptoms of acidity and metabolic acidosis.

    Side Effects Of ALKA SODA SACHET

    Common

    • abdominal cramps
    • flatulence (gas)
    • high blood pressure

    Uncommon

    • muscles weakness and cramps due to alkalosis
    • hypokalaemia (low potassium levels)
    • fluid retention

    Rare

    Stop taking ALKA SODA SACHET and consult your doctor immediately in case you experience:

    • severe allergic reaction such as swelling in lips, face, neck, which may cause difficulty in breathing, skin rashes, hives

    Interactions

    A. Drug-Drug interactions:

    Before taking ALKA SODA SACHET, inform your doctor if you are taking any of the following medicine:

    • antibiotics such as rifampicin, tetracycline, benzyl penicillin potassium (medicines used for bacterial infections)
    • ketoconazole, itraconazole (medicine used for management of fungal infection)
    • phenothiazines, gabapentin, phenytoin (medicines used for management of anxiety or depression)
    • corticosteroids such as daflazacort (to manage swelling and inflammation or for allergic reactions)
    • lithium (for mental illness)
    • methotrexate (medicine used for management of certain types of tumours, psoriasis or rheumatoid arthritis)
    • quinidine or dipyridamole (medicine used to manage heart rhythm disorders)
    • ephedrine (medicines used for management of breathing problems)
    • chloroquine (medicines used for management or management of malaria)
    • penicillamine (medicine used for management rheumatism)
    • dipyridamole (medicine used for management blood clots associated with heart problems)
    • adrenaline hydrochloride (medicine used for management of severe allergic reactions)
    • carmustine, nilotinib (medicines used in cancer management)
    • glycopyrronium bromide (a medicine used to reduce saliva secretion)
    • isoprenaline hydrochloride, digoxin or dipyridamole (medicines used management of various heart problems)
    • suxamethonium chloride (medicine used as muscle relaxant)
    • lithium (a medicine used for management of manic depression)
    • lansoprazole (a medicine used for management of stomach ulcers and acidity)
    • levothyroxine (a medicine used for management of hypoactive thyroid)
    • mycophenolate (a medicine used to stop transplant rejection)
    • rosuvastatin (a medicine used for management of high cholesterol levels)
    • hydrochloroquine (a medicine used for management of arthritis)
    • penicillamine (medicine used management of rheumatoid arthritis)
    • fexofenadine (a medicine used for management of allergic reactions)
    • sulpiride (medicine used for management of schizophrenia)
    • Non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) such as aspirin, diflunisal (medicines used for pain management)
    • ACE inhibitors such as captopril, enalapril (medicines used for management of for heart failure or high blood pressure)
    • antivirals for viral infections such as atazanavir, tipranavir (medicines used for management of viral infections)
    • bisphosphonates (medicines used for management of osteoporosis)
